What's the Best Sleep Position?
Practise you sleep on your back, side, or belly? Y'all may have a favorite sleeping position, or you may change it upward at present and then. And if you lot become pregnant, or take certain health problems, the style y'all sleep tin sometimes change. In those cases, getting your sleeping posture right can brand a big divergence in the way you feel when yous wake up. Are you choosing the best sleeping position for your situation?
Sleeping in the incorrect way can cause or aggravate cervix or back pain. It may besides obstruct the airways to your lungs, leading to issues like obstructive sleep apnea. Some enquiry fifty-fifty suggests that the wrong sleeping position may cause toxins to filter out of your brain more slowly. Exercise You Slumber on Your Stomach?
Approximately 7% of people sleep on their stomach. This is sometimes chosen the decumbent position. Information technology may help ease snoring by shifting fleshy obstructions from your airway. But sleeping in this position may aggravate other medical weather condition.
Your cervix and spine are not in a neutral position when you sleep on your breadbasket. This may crusade neck and back pain. Stomach sleeping can put pressure on fretfulness and cause numbness, tingling, and nerve pain.
It's best to choose another sleep position if yous are a stomach sleeper. If you can't break the habit, prop your brow upwards on a pillow so your head and spine remain in a neutral position and you have room to breathe.

Do Yous Sleep on Your Back?
Back-sleeping has its advantages and disadvantages, too. Sleep experts refer to this as the supine position.
Let's get-go with the bad news. Some people who sleep on their backs may feel low back pain. It can too make existing back pain worse, so this is not the all-time sleep position for lower back hurting. If you endure from snoring or slumber apnea, sleeping on your dorsum may aggravate these weather condition as well. Women should avert this position during late pregnancy.
There are health benefits to sleeping on your back, also. Your caput, neck, and spine are in a neutral position and then you lot're less likely to experience neck pain. Sleeping on your back with your head slightly elevated with a small-scale pillow is considered the all-time sleeping position for heartburn.

Do y'all slumber on your side?
The side sleeping position is the virtually popular past far. Information technology's as well known every bit lateral sleeping position past sleep scientists.
This position may be good for those who snore. If you have some forms of arthritis, sleeping in the side position may brand yous sore, though. Curling up may also prevent you from animate deeply because doing and so may restrict your diaphragm.
Side-Sleeping and Encephalon Waste
It's possible that sleeping on your side could be good for your brain. Scientists recently learned that our brains clear out waste more quickly while we sleep.
Whether or non the position you sleep in influences this waste removal is unclear. But ane study performed on rats suggests side-sleeping might clear brain waste matter more efficiently than other postures.

The Fetal Position
Approximately 41% of people slumber using a specific side position by curling up on their sides with their knees bent. Side sleepers who sleep with their legs bent and curled toward their torsos are sleeping in the fetal position.
Some studies suggest that more women than men sleep in this position, although other research disputes this. Information technology may be a good choice for pregnant women because this posture improves circulation for both the mother and fetus.
If sleeping this way hurts your hips, placing a pillow between your knees may help relieve force per unit area.

The Spooning Position
Spooning is a side sleeping position for couples; the person in the back holds the one in the front end close to their body. As with other postures, this one comes with its ain advantages and disadvantages. As for disadvantages, couples may wake up more than ofttimes sleeping this way, as you are more likely to exist jostled past your partner.
But spooning allows for cuddling, likewise, which stimulates the release of oxytocin. This is a hormone that promotes bonding, decreases stress, and may help y'all get to sleep more quickly. Cuddling for as petty as 10 minutes is enough to trigger the release of oxytocin.
What Side is Best for GERD?
Believe it or not, knowing the best side to sleep on may reduce your acid reflux symptoms. Sleeping on your right side can cause more acrid to leak through your esophagus. Sleeping on your breadbasket or dorsum makes GERD symptoms worse, too. To lower the take chances of GERD problems, patients usually sleep all-time on their left sides.
Side-Sleeping and Heart Failure
People with congestive center failure avoid sleeping on their backs and their left sides. Their heartbeats may disturb their sleep in these postures. These patients tend to prefer sleeping on their right side. In fact, sleeping on the right side may protect people with heart failure from further health damage.

All-time Sleeping Position for Snoring and Sleep Apnea
To minimize the take chances of snoring, it's commonly best to slumber on your side. Sleeping on your dorsum may aggravate snoring, but for a smaller number of snorers, dorsum sleeping helps them feel more restful the side by side day.
Tips to Finish Snoring
If you snore, but still want to slumber on your back, attempt stacking a few pillows underneath your head to reduce the gamble of snoring. If snoring wakes you lot up or if you wake upwards gasping or feel tired during the solar day, it's time to encounter your md.
Sleep Apnea
Severe or loud snoring may exist a sign of sleep apnea, a condition that causes you lot to stop and offset breathing while you sleep due to airway obstructions. Sleep apnea is associated with high blood pressure, center affliction, and stroke.
If y'all have sleep apnea, the style y'all sleep is well-known to influence how sleepy yous feel throughout the next day.
One large study found that nigh patients with obstructive slumber apnea slept improve on their sides, experienced less interrupted sleep, and were more wakeful the next day. Yet, this aforementioned study found that people with severe OSA actually felt sleepier the side by side day if they slept on their sides, as compared to their backs. Best Sleeping Positions for Back, Shoulder, and Neck Hurting
If you have back pain, sleeping on your tum or back may aggravate your pain. Switch to side sleeping to minimize your hazard of back pain.
For farther relief, put a pillow between your knees to keep your hips in alignment. If you must slumber on your dorsum, placing a pillow nether your knees will take some strain off of your dorsum.
Shoulder, Neck, and Upper Back Pain
Arthritis and other painful conditions along your upper spine can worsen or improve while you sleep. Studies seem to disagree, though, on what positions are ideal.
One large written report found that people had less shoulder pain who slept in the starfish position—on their backs, with easily up near their breast or head. But it couldn't explain if those people had less shoulder hurting considering of the way they slept, or if they slept that way because they had less pain.
A subsequently study found that people who slept on their backs with their arms at their sides—the soldier position—activated their shoulder muscles less, and thus may experience less shoulder pain.
All-time Sleeping Positions During Pregnancy
If y'all are pregnant, sleeping on your stomach or back will exist uncomfortable or impossible. You will exist most comfortable sleeping on your side. Favor your left side to maximize circulation for both you and your babe. Placing a body pillow or pillow nether your abdomen can help relieve back pain. Identify another pillow betwixt your legs and bend your knees to exist even more comfortable.
Avert This Position During Pregnancy
You lot've probably already heard this from your physician, but simply in instance—significant women should not sleep on their backs during the third trimester of pregnancy. For more than than half a century, we've known that significant back sleepers are reducing blood menses to their fetus.
Only only recently researchers discovered that this sleep style also raises the risk of a stillbirth, even in otherwise healthy pregnancies. Yous should also avoid lying on your back during the day—simply 30 minutes of this posture has been shown to force your fetus to shift to a land that requires less oxygen to survive. These results propose that lying on your back—even for a brusk remainder—reduces the oxygen available to your fetus.
Is Your Mattress Comfy?
Mattresses are made of a variety of materials. Some are softer or firmer. The type of material that a mattress is made out of affect your body temperature.
When it comes to the firmness of a mattress, you want one that is firm enough to support your spine, simply also soft enough to accommodate to the shape of your body. People who endure from dorsum pain may be most comfortable on a mattress that is softer and more cushioning.
Y'all can't know for sure how your mattress will work out until y'all've been resting on information technology for a while. When shopping for a mattress, buy one from a store that will permit you test information technology for several weeks and substitution it if it doesn't work for you.
Can Sleeping Posture Predict Your Personality?
That depends on what you consider "personality." In the 70s and 80s, some researchers claimed they could use sleeping postures to predict if someone were impulsive, feminine, broken-hearted, self-confident--even whether they could be hypnotized.
More contempo studies have bandage doubt on these theories. The research has been criticized for using "woefully pocket-size" numbers of sleepers. Many contradictions accept been institute betwixt these studies as well.
A more than recent attempt to associate personality traits to body positions during sleep came upwardly empty-handed. It showed only a "very weak relationship between sleep positions and personality," and, using predictions from earlier models, failed to reliably predict the participants' personality traits.
Merely on the Other Mitt...
Fifty-fifty if before studies are unreliable, there may be another way that our sleep postures say something most our personalities. Some sleeping positions are associated with well-rested sleepers. Possibly people who prefer them wake up less crabby and irritable, and are more alert during the solar day.
Hither are some examples, using the Big Five personality traits. A grouping of 22,000 American and Japanese adults were measured over ten years. The ones who slept poorly tended to become less conscientious over time. The ones who slept best were the about extroverted and the least neurotic.
So, at the end of the twenty-four hour period, the best sleeping position for you may simply be the i that leaves you feeling your best the next day.
